The TRS-80 Model 100 has its system bus expansion port on the bottom. The Tandy 102, the successor to the TRS-80 Model 100 has its expansion port on the back of the unit. The connector looks like a parallel port, but is not a parallel port. The Model 100 and Tandy 102 have a parallel port but the connector looks and is compatible with the internal parallel port to motherboard cable used in PCs. -- John.
